            Figure 3. Development of bone organoids by three-dimensional bioprinting. (A) In vitro osteogenic ability of optimized bioink. (B) In vitro self-
            mineralization of bioprinted bone organoids. (C) Total mineral volume and mineral density of organoids. (D) Macroscopic images of bone organoids
            cultured for 20 days and 40 days in vitro. (E) Enhanced osteogenic ability of bioprinted bone organoids in vivo. (F) Immunohistochemical staining after
            40 days of in vivo culture. Scale bar, 1mm and 50 μm, respectively. (G) CT reconstruction of repaired rat skull defects after bone organoid implantation.
